aludel
/ˈæljʊdel/noun
- a pear-shaped earthenware or glass pot, open at both ends to enable a series to be fitted one above another, formerly used in sublimation and other chemical processes梨形罐, 梨状升华器。
词源
late Middle English: from Old French alutel, via Spanish from Arabic al-'uṭāl 'the sublimation vessel'.
